The Chakras are energy centers of light.

These Chakras make up the energy body of your physiology.

These Chakras range from the bottom of your spine up through the crown of your head.

There is a different color associated with each Chakra.

The color red is the Root Chakra at the base of the spine.

The next Chakra is orange; then follows yellow, and then green, the heart Chakra.

Next is blue, the Throat Chakra; then indigo, the Third Eye, and finally ultraviolet, the Crown Chakra.

This is the same spectrum of color as the rainbow, or as the light thrown off by a crystal glass.
